From b4615801e94143c80223e4dff19d40a5d382fe6d Mon Sep 17 00:00:00 2001 From: ambrose Date: Wed, 3 Jul 2019 01:43:07 +0000 Subject: [PATCH] [SKIP CI] Automatically updating .drone.yml --- .drone.yml | 382 +---------------------------------------------------- 1 file changed, 2 insertions(+), 380 deletions(-) diff --git a/.drone.yml b/.drone.yml index 7593547..3e7bce2 100644 --- a/.drone.yml +++ b/.drone.yml @@ -35,382 +35,13 @@ trigger: - pull_request --- kind: pipeline -name: backend-auth -clone: - depth: 32 -steps: - - name: submodule - image: plugins/git - settings: - recursive: true - submodule_override: - backend-auth: 'https://git.makerforce.io/beep/backend-auth.git' - backend-core: 'https://git.makerforce.io/beep/backend-core.git' - backend-heartbeat: 'https://git.makerforce.io/beep/backend-heartbeat.git' - backend-login: 'https://git.makerforce.io/beep/backend-login.git' - backend-permissions: 'https://git.makerforce.io/beep/backend-permissions.git' - backend-pictures: 'https://git.makerforce.io/beep/backend-pictures.git' - backend-store: 'https://git.makerforce.io/beep/backend-store.git' - backend-transcription: 'https://git.makerforce.io/beep/backend-transcription.git' - backend-webrtc: 'https://git.makerforce.io/beep/backend-webrtc.git' - - name: docker - image: plugins/docker - settings: - registry: registry.makerforce.io - repo: registry.makerforce.io/beep/backend-auth - context: backend-auth - dockerfile: backend-auth/Dockerfile - auto_tag: true - username: - from_secret: docker_username - password: - from_secret: docker_password -trigger: - branch: - - master - event: - - push - - tag - - promote - - rollback ---- -kind: pipeline -name: backend-core -clone: - depth: 32 -steps: - - name: submodule - image: plugins/git - settings: - recursive: true - submodule_override: - backend-auth: 'https://git.makerforce.io/beep/backend-auth.git' - backend-core: 'https://git.makerforce.io/beep/backend-core.git' - backend-heartbeat: 'https://git.makerforce.io/beep/backend-heartbeat.git' - backend-login: 'https://git.makerforce.io/beep/backend-login.git' - backend-permissions: 'https://git.makerforce.io/beep/backend-permissions.git' - backend-pictures: 'https://git.makerforce.io/beep/backend-pictures.git' - backend-store: 'https://git.makerforce.io/beep/backend-store.git' - backend-transcription: 'https://git.makerforce.io/beep/backend-transcription.git' - backend-webrtc: 'https://git.makerforce.io/beep/backend-webrtc.git' - - name: docker - image: plugins/docker - settings: - registry: registry.makerforce.io - repo: registry.makerforce.io/beep/backend-core - context: backend-core - dockerfile: backend-core/Dockerfile - auto_tag: true - username: - from_secret: docker_username - password: - from_secret: docker_password -trigger: - branch: - - master - event: - - push - - tag - - promote - - rollback ---- -kind: pipeline -name: backend-heartbeat -clone: - depth: 32 -steps: - - name: submodule - image: plugins/git - settings: - recursive: true - submodule_override: - backend-auth: 'https://git.makerforce.io/beep/backend-auth.git' - backend-core: 'https://git.makerforce.io/beep/backend-core.git' - backend-heartbeat: 'https://git.makerforce.io/beep/backend-heartbeat.git' - backend-login: 'https://git.makerforce.io/beep/backend-login.git' - backend-permissions: 'https://git.makerforce.io/beep/backend-permissions.git' - backend-pictures: 'https://git.makerforce.io/beep/backend-pictures.git' - backend-store: 'https://git.makerforce.io/beep/backend-store.git' - backend-transcription: 'https://git.makerforce.io/beep/backend-transcription.git' - backend-webrtc: 'https://git.makerforce.io/beep/backend-webrtc.git' - - name: docker - image: plugins/docker - settings: - registry: registry.makerforce.io - repo: registry.makerforce.io/beep/backend-heartbeat - context: backend-heartbeat - dockerfile: backend-heartbeat/Dockerfile - auto_tag: true - username: - from_secret: docker_username - password: - from_secret: docker_password -trigger: - branch: - - master - event: - - push - - tag - - promote - - rollback ---- -kind: pipeline -name: backend-login -clone: - depth: 32 -steps: - - name: submodule - image: plugins/git - settings: - recursive: true - submodule_override: - backend-auth: 'https://git.makerforce.io/beep/backend-auth.git' - backend-core: 'https://git.makerforce.io/beep/backend-core.git' - backend-heartbeat: 'https://git.makerforce.io/beep/backend-heartbeat.git' - backend-login: 'https://git.makerforce.io/beep/backend-login.git' - backend-permissions: 'https://git.makerforce.io/beep/backend-permissions.git' - backend-pictures: 'https://git.makerforce.io/beep/backend-pictures.git' - backend-store: 'https://git.makerforce.io/beep/backend-store.git' - backend-transcription: 'https://git.makerforce.io/beep/backend-transcription.git' - backend-webrtc: 'https://git.makerforce.io/beep/backend-webrtc.git' - - name: docker - image: plugins/docker - settings: - registry: registry.makerforce.io - repo: registry.makerforce.io/beep/backend-login - context: backend-login - dockerfile: backend-login/Dockerfile - auto_tag: true - username: - from_secret: docker_username - password: - from_secret: docker_password -trigger: - branch: - - master - event: - - push - - tag - - promote - - rollback ---- -kind: pipeline -name: backend-permissions -clone: - depth: 32 -steps: - - name: submodule - image: plugins/git - settings: - recursive: true - submodule_override: - backend-auth: 'https://git.makerforce.io/beep/backend-auth.git' - backend-core: 'https://git.makerforce.io/beep/backend-core.git' - backend-heartbeat: 'https://git.makerforce.io/beep/backend-heartbeat.git' - backend-login: 'https://git.makerforce.io/beep/backend-login.git' - backend-permissions: 'https://git.makerforce.io/beep/backend-permissions.git' - backend-pictures: 'https://git.makerforce.io/beep/backend-pictures.git' - backend-store: 'https://git.makerforce.io/beep/backend-store.git' - backend-transcription: 'https://git.makerforce.io/beep/backend-transcription.git' - backend-webrtc: 'https://git.makerforce.io/beep/backend-webrtc.git' - - name: docker - image: plugins/docker - settings: - registry: registry.makerforce.io - repo: registry.makerforce.io/beep/backend-permissions - context: backend-permissions - dockerfile: backend-permissions/Dockerfile - auto_tag: true - username: - from_secret: docker_username - password: - from_secret: docker_password -trigger: - branch: - - master - event: - - push - - tag - - promote - - rollback ---- -kind: pipeline -name: backend-pictures -clone: - depth: 32 -steps: - - name: submodule - image: plugins/git - settings: - recursive: true - submodule_override: - backend-auth: 'https://git.makerforce.io/beep/backend-auth.git' - backend-core: 'https://git.makerforce.io/beep/backend-core.git' - backend-heartbeat: 'https://git.makerforce.io/beep/backend-heartbeat.git' - backend-login: 'https://git.makerforce.io/beep/backend-login.git' - backend-permissions: 'https://git.makerforce.io/beep/backend-permissions.git' - backend-pictures: 'https://git.makerforce.io/beep/backend-pictures.git' - backend-store: 'https://git.makerforce.io/beep/backend-store.git' - backend-transcription: 'https://git.makerforce.io/beep/backend-transcription.git' - backend-webrtc: 'https://git.makerforce.io/beep/backend-webrtc.git' - - name: docker - image: plugins/docker - settings: - registry: registry.makerforce.io - repo: registry.makerforce.io/beep/backend-pictures - context: backend-pictures - dockerfile: backend-pictures/Dockerfile - auto_tag: true - username: - from_secret: docker_username - password: - from_secret: docker_password -trigger: - branch: - - master - event: - - push - - tag - - promote - - rollback ---- -kind: pipeline -name: backend-store -clone: - depth: 32 -steps: - - name: submodule - image: plugins/git - settings: - recursive: true - submodule_override: - backend-auth: 'https://git.makerforce.io/beep/backend-auth.git' - backend-core: 'https://git.makerforce.io/beep/backend-core.git' - backend-heartbeat: 'https://git.makerforce.io/beep/backend-heartbeat.git' - backend-login: 'https://git.makerforce.io/beep/backend-login.git' - backend-permissions: 'https://git.makerforce.io/beep/backend-permissions.git' - backend-pictures: 'https://git.makerforce.io/beep/backend-pictures.git' - backend-store: 'https://git.makerforce.io/beep/backend-store.git' - backend-transcription: 'https://git.makerforce.io/beep/backend-transcription.git' - backend-webrtc: 'https://git.makerforce.io/beep/backend-webrtc.git' - - name: docker - image: plugins/docker - settings: - registry: registry.makerforce.io - repo: registry.makerforce.io/beep/backend-store - context: backend-store - dockerfile: backend-store/Dockerfile - auto_tag: true - username: - from_secret: docker_username - password: - from_secret: docker_password -trigger: - branch: - - master - event: - - push - - tag - - promote - - rollback ---- -kind: pipeline -name: backend-transcription -clone: - depth: 32 -steps: - - name: submodule - image: plugins/git - settings: - recursive: true - submodule_override: - backend-auth: 'https://git.makerforce.io/beep/backend-auth.git' - backend-core: 'https://git.makerforce.io/beep/backend-core.git' - backend-heartbeat: 'https://git.makerforce.io/beep/backend-heartbeat.git' - backend-login: 'https://git.makerforce.io/beep/backend-login.git' - backend-permissions: 'https://git.makerforce.io/beep/backend-permissions.git' - backend-pictures: 'https://git.makerforce.io/beep/backend-pictures.git' - backend-store: 'https://git.makerforce.io/beep/backend-store.git' - backend-transcription: 'https://git.makerforce.io/beep/backend-transcription.git' - backend-webrtc: 'https://git.makerforce.io/beep/backend-webrtc.git' - - name: docker - image: plugins/docker - settings: - registry: registry.makerforce.io - repo: registry.makerforce.io/beep/backend-transcription - context: backend-transcription - dockerfile: backend-transcription/Dockerfile - auto_tag: true - username: - from_secret: docker_username - password: - from_secret: docker_password -trigger: - branch: - - master - event: - - push - - tag - - promote - - rollback ---- -kind: pipeline -name: backend-webrtc -clone: - depth: 32 -steps: - - name: submodule - image: plugins/git - settings: - recursive: true - submodule_override: - backend-auth: 'https://git.makerforce.io/beep/backend-auth.git' - backend-core: 'https://git.makerforce.io/beep/backend-core.git' - backend-heartbeat: 'https://git.makerforce.io/beep/backend-heartbeat.git' - backend-login: 'https://git.makerforce.io/beep/backend-login.git' - backend-permissions: 'https://git.makerforce.io/beep/backend-permissions.git' - backend-pictures: 'https://git.makerforce.io/beep/backend-pictures.git' - backend-store: 'https://git.makerforce.io/beep/backend-store.git' - backend-transcription: 'https://git.makerforce.io/beep/backend-transcription.git' - backend-webrtc: 'https://git.makerforce.io/beep/backend-webrtc.git' - - name: docker - image: plugins/docker - settings: - registry: registry.makerforce.io - repo: registry.makerforce.io/beep/backend-webrtc - context: backend-webrtc - dockerfile: backend-webrtc/Dockerfile - auto_tag: true - username: - from_secret: docker_username - password: - from_secret: docker_password -trigger: - branch: - - master - event: - - push - - tag - - promote - - rollback ---- -kind: pipeline name: deploy steps: - name: submodule image: plugins/git settings: recursive: true - submodule_override: - backend-auth: 'https://git.makerforce.io/beep/backend-auth.git' - backend-core: 'https://git.makerforce.io/beep/backend-core.git' - backend-heartbeat: 'https://git.makerforce.io/beep/backend-heartbeat.git' - backend-login: 'https://git.makerforce.io/beep/backend-login.git' - backend-permissions: 'https://git.makerforce.io/beep/backend-permissions.git' - backend-pictures: 'https://git.makerforce.io/beep/backend-pictures.git' - backend-store: 'https://git.makerforce.io/beep/backend-store.git' - backend-transcription: 'https://git.makerforce.io/beep/backend-transcription.git' - backend-webrtc: 'https://git.makerforce.io/beep/backend-webrtc.git' + submodule_override: {} - name: copy-docker-compose image: appleboy/drone-scp settings: @@ -459,13 +90,4 @@ trigger: - tag - promote - rollback -depends_on: - - backend-auth - - backend-core - - backend-heartbeat - - backend-login - - backend-permissions - - backend-pictures - - backend-store - - backend-transcription - - backend-webrtc +depends_on: []